What are the main components of the digestive system and their roles in digestion?

Main components: mouth, salivary glands, esophagus, stomach, small intestine, large intestine, liver, pancreas.

The main components of the digestive system are the mouth, salivary glands, esophagus, stomach, small intestine, large intestine, liver, and pancreas. Each plays a specific role in breaking down food, absorbing nutrients, and eliminating waste.

More Information

The digestive system processes food to extract nutrients and energy and discards waste. Each part has a specific function, like breaking down food with enzymes or absorbing nutrients.

Tips

Common mistakes include confusing the sequence of digestion processes and misunderstanding the function of accessory organs like the liver and pancreas.
